The Evolution of Slot Machines
The timeline of gambling with slots can be followed to the late 19th century the first mechanical slot machine. These early devices, known as “liberty bell” machines, included three spinning reels and simple symbols like fruits, bells, and lucky sevens. Players would activate a lever to spin the reels, and winning combinations would pay out based on a specific paytable. This groundbreaking innovation quickly garnered popularity in bars and public houses, leading to the evolution of gambling entertainment.
As technology advanced, so did slot games. The 1960s saw the arrival of the initial electromechanical slot machines, which enabled more intricate gameplay and enhanced features. Such devices featured multiple paylines and exciting themes, enchanting players with their engaging designs. The launch of electronic slots in the 1990s marked a major turning point, which led to digital displays and complex animations. As a result, slot gambling transformed from basic designs into a dazzling experience that appealed to a broader audience.
The rise of the online technology in the late 1990s opened the door to online slot gambling. Virtual casinos started to appear, offering players the ease of enjoying their preferred games from home. Online slots retained the ingenuity seen in their land-based equivalents while also including innovative features like progressive jackpots and bonus rounds. This transition not only broadened the reach of slot gambling but also allowed for a varied themes and narratives, further enriching the storytelling aspect that draws in players in the present.
